NCT03835312 — Sequential Transplantation of UCBSCs and Islet Cells in Children and Adolescents With Monogenic Immunodeficiency T1DM

StatusRecruiting
PhaseN/A
SponsorChildren’s Hospital of Fudan University
Enrollment50
Study TypeINTERVENTIONAL
ConditionsDiabetes Mellitus, Type 1; Immunologic Deficiency Syndromes
Interventions

This study evaluates the efficacy of sequential transplantation of umbilical cord blood stem cells and islet cells in children with monogenic immunodeficiency type 1 diabetes mellitus. Umbilical cord blood stem cell transplantation will be performed first. Children with stable immune reconstruction will than receive islet cell transplantation.

NCT06770621 — Longitudinal Study of the GLUcagon REsponse to Hypoglycemia in Children and Adolescents With New-onset Type 1 DIAbetes

StatusRecruiting
PhaseN/A
SponsorCliniques universitaires Saint-Luc- Université Catholique de Louvain
Enrollment1000
Study TypeINTERVENTIONAL
ConditionsSevere Hypoglycemia; Type1diabetes
Interventions; ;

The GLUREDIA study investigates the counter-regulatory response (CRR) during hypoglycemia in children with type 1 diabetes (T1D). Hypoglycemia can lead to severe symptoms, but is normally counteracted by CRR, corresponding to the secretion of hormones to maintain normoglycemia. NCT06783309 — CNP-103 in Adolescent and Adult Subjects Ages 12-35 With Recently Diagnosed (Within 6 Months) Stage 3 Type 1 Diabetes (T1D)

StatusRecruiting
PhasePhase 1 / Phase 2
SponsorCOUR Pharmaceutical Development Company, Inc.
Enrollment72
Study TypeINTERVENTIONAL
ConditionsType 1 Diabetes Mellitus; T1D; T1DM; T1DM - Type 1 Diabetes Mellitus; Type 1 Diabetes in Adolescence
Interventions;

This study is a Phase 1b/2a First-in-Human (FIH) clinical trial to assess the safety, tolerability, pharmacodynamics (PD), and efficacy of multiple ascending doses of CNP-103. The approximately 393-days study consists of a Screening Period (28 days), Treatment Period (90 days), and Post-Dose Evaluations (275 days).

NCT04598893 — Recent-Onset Type 1 Diabetes Extension Study Evaluating the Long-Term Safety of Teplizumab (PROTECT Extension)

StatusActive, not recruiting
PhaseN/A
SponsorProvention Bio, a Sanofi Company
Enrollment188
Study TypeOBSERVATIONAL
ConditionsDiabetes Mellitus, Type 1
Interventions;

The purpose of this non-interventional extension study is to continue to collect long-term safety and other clinical data for an additional 42 months in participants who completed the PROTECT study.

NCT06624943 — Introducing Biosimilar Insulin Glargine to the Treatment Regimen of Children and Youth with Type 1 Diabetes in Mali

StatusCompleted
PhasePhase 4
SponsorLife for a Child Program, Diabetes Australia
Enrollment260
Study TypeINTERVENTIONAL
ConditionsType 1 Diabetes (T1D)
Interventions

This study aimed to evaluate the impact on blood glucose control and quality of life in children and youth with type 1 diabetes in Mali by switching the insulin regimen from human insulin via needle and syringe, to long-acting biosimilar insulin glargine delivered by reusable pens combined with short-acting insulin via needle and syringe.
